Position : Staff Engineer - C / Embedded / Validation
Years of Experience : 3 to 5 years
Job Location : Bangalore / Kochi
Mandatory Skills
1. Strong experience in Coding and Development with C programming language
2. Experience in Testing (Integration Testing) of device driver / firmware in platforms with Linux or Any RTOS or Baremetal.
3. Experience with Linux environments for development of C based applications, building, flashing, debugging
- Knowledge of two or more protocols : UART, I2C, SPI, USB
- Knowledge of ARM and / or x86 SoC Architecture
- Debugging experience
- Debugger interface knowledge (Coresight / UltraSoC, Lauterbach, JTAG)
- Strong experience in one or more scripting languages : Python, Shell scripting
- Experience in test automation (using Python or Shell scripting)
- Experience in Testing (Integration Testing) of device driver / firmware in platforms with Linux or Any RTOS or Baremetal
- Experience in Unit Testing (one or more tools from VectorCast, GTest)
- Good communication and Problem Solving skills